Position Overview
We are seeking an experienced Manufacturing Controls Engineer to serve as a technical owner for automation and controls within a high-volume manufacturing plant. This role applies advanced controls, electrical, networking, and problem-solving expertise to maintain safe, reliable production while leading improvements that affect quality, cost, delivery, responsiveness, and throughput.
The successful candidate will work independently with minimal direction, exercise sound judgment on complex production and project issues, and influence decisions across Manufacturing Engineering, Manufacturing, Maintenance, Quality, Safety, IT, suppliers, and OEM partners. The engineer will also serve as a technical resource and mentor for less-experienced engineers and plant personnel.
What You’ll Do
-
Own the controls performance, reliability, and technical health of assigned manufacturing processes and equipment.
-
Lead the diagnosis, containment, root-cause analysis, and permanent resolution of production, quality, safety, and equipment issues.
-
Lead controls design and execution for new equipment, process changes, launches, retooling, and continuous-improvement projects from concept through plant acceptance and buyoff.
-
Coordinate and provide technical direction to OEMs, system integrators, contractors, and suppliers; manage open issues through closure and verify that deliverables meet plant and GM requirements.
-
Apply applicable GM controls, electrical, network, safety, cybersecurity, documentation, and software standards to new and legacy equipment.
-
Integrate new technologies and plant-floor systems into existing architectures while protecting production uptime and maintainability.
-
Use data-driven problem solving and continuous-improvement methods to improve OEE, downtime, cycle time, scrap, first-time quality, energy use, and operator safety.
-
Develop standard work, technical documentation, training materials, backups, and lessons learned to improve repeatability and prevent recurrence.
-
Mentor engineers, skilled trades, and cross-functional partners on controls troubleshooting, standards, and best practices.
-
Provide production support across shifts, including off-shift, weekend, launch, and major-repair support as required by plant operations.
Required Qualifications
-
Bachelor of Science deg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Controls Engineering, or a related discipline; equivalent relevant experience may be considered.
-
Five or more years of hands-on experience with industrial automation, manufacturing controls, or plant-floor systems.
-
Demonstrated experience independently owning complex controls problems and leading projects to completion.
-
Strong electrical troubleshooting skills, including the ability to read schematics, troubleshoot control panels, and safely test industrial equipment.
-
Strong programming, analytical, communication, and technical documentation skills.
-
Ability to work effectively in a fast-paced production environment and make sound decisions under time pressure.
-
Ability to lead through influence across multiple functions and manage competing priorities.
Preferred Qualifications / Competitive Edge
-
Proficiency with industrial networks and protocols, including EtherNet/IP, TCP/IP, PROFINET, and PROFIBUS.
-
Experience with Rockwell ControlLogix or GuardLogix and Siemens S7-300/400 or related Siemens platforms.
-
Experience with Rockwell FactoryTalk View and Siemens TIA Portal.
-
Experience with Siemens G120/S120 drives and Rockwell PowerFlex/Kinetix motion and drive systems.
-
Working knowledge of GM common controls architectures, templates, standards, and plant-floor systems.
-
Experience with electrical design and documentation tools such as EPLAN, AutoCAD Electrical, or equivalent.
